Men's Lacrosse scores program best 18 goals to defeat Franciscan

The Muskingum men's lacrosse team netted a program-best 18 goals en route to defeating Franciscan on Wednesday afternoon, 18-8.  

The Basics 

  • Records: Muskingum (5-9 overall), Franciscan (7-7 overall)
  • Location: Steubenville, Ohio - Memorial Field 

Game Notes

  • The 18-goal outburst is the most by any team in Muskingum men's lacrosse program history, breaking the previous record of 15 set in 2015. 

Inside the Numbers

  • Muskingum was led by junior Zach Kern with a career-best five goals and one assist.
  • Junior Tucker Haas, sophomore Jake Stewart and freshman Nick Klinefelter all recorded three goals each.
  • The Muskies scored 18 goals on a season-best 62 shots, 31 of which were on frame.
  • Junior Phillip Dappen registered the win in goal playing 50 minutes making 11 saves.
  • Franciscan was led in the contest by Jonas McCaig and Dan McCartney with three goals each.
  • Franciscan struck first in the contest before the Muskies rallied scoring five straight goals to claim the 5-1 advantage.
  • The Muskies and Barons exchanged goals for much of the second period before junior Ian McGougan delivered a man-up goal to give Muskingum the 9-6 halftime lead.
  • The Muskingum attack erupted in the second half scoring six straight goals to extend its lead, 15-6.
  • Senior Ryan Walsh delivered the final dagger of the contest with 3:06 remaining in the fourth en route to the win.
